A Novel Tool Path Generation Method Based on the Theory of Digital Copy
Abstract
In the porcelain denture manufacturing, obtaining the cutter location data is the primary step that drive NC machine to grind denture. Referring the method of copying manufacturing, this article introduced a novel cutter location data acquisition method. According to the method, used same shape probe with the grinding bur to scan a temporary mental denture along planned grinding tool path, then recorded the scanning data, namely the cutter location point following grinding porcelain denture. This article gave an experiment finally, scanned a metal molar and ground a porcelain block using the scanning data, and then obtained a perfect porcelain molar.
